WebJustine Moritz The housekeeper for the Frankenstein family. Accused of William's murder, Justine is the stolid martyr who goes to her death with grace and dignity. If William's death symbolizes the loss of innocence, Justine's death marks the end of all that is noble and righteous. The De Lacey family M. De Lacey, Felix, Agatha, and Safie. WebWilliam Frankenstein Victor's youngest brother who is killed by the monster. Two German films, The Golem (1914) and Homunculus (1916), dealt with a similar theme derived from Jewish … list of good drugsFrankenstein is a frame story written in epistolary form. It documents a fictional correspondence between Captain Robert Walton and his sister, Margaret Walton Saville. The story takes place in the eighteenth century (the letters are dated as "17-"). Robert Walton is a failed writer who sets out to explore the North Pole in hopes of expanding scientific knowledge. During the voyage, the crew spots a dog sled driven by a gigantic figure.
